Ancient Greek

Pronunciation

 

Etymology 1

Adverbial accusative of χείρων (kheírōn, worse)

Adverb

χεῖρον (kheîron)

  1. worse

Adjective

χεῖρον (kheîron)

  1. inflection of χείρων (kheírōn):
    1. neuter nominative/accusative singular
    2. masculine/feminine/neuter vocative singular
